Continuing On Our Adventure

As part of the fun of Kansas City (two weeks ago) we visited cousins. Both of my mil's sisters live in the Kansas City area so we were able to go and see both of them. We went out to the stables to visit their (mil's neices family) horses. I knew that The Boy would be thrilled. I wasn't sure what Miss Thing would do.

They had one of them saddled with a child size saddle so the big kids got a chance to go for a ride. Whether or not they took that chance was another story.

The Boy volunteered himself to go first but as soon as he was sitting in the saddle he was signing, and saying, "done." In fact the closer he got to being up on the horse the louder I heard him. He didn't wouldn't even sit long enough for me to take a picture.

Little Miss, I must say, really surprised me. I kept asking her if she wanted to go. And showing no emotion she just kept nodding her head.

They went around once and we asked her if she wanted to go again, still without expression, she nodded. It was quite funny.
 Still nothing. Are you having fun girl?

When she got down I asked her if she had fun. All she would do was nod her head. Of course later on she would excitedly tell almost anyone who would listen that she road on a big horse.

She indulged us by sitting up there for a photo-op. Although her brother, the whole time she was up there, just kept signing/saying "done."
He didn't mind getting close and petting. The whole idea of riding, though, was out of the question. I wasn't all that surprised by his reaction. He likes to try stuff but once he is done he is done. Things have to be on his terms. I think rides, of any sort, fall out of that category with him being in control of his situation.

After that we went to visit, and stay the night at, my mil's other sister. It was a nice visit. Wonderful to get out of the house. And fun to get to do some out of the ordinary things. We couldn't leave the city without visting my mil's parents. The weather was wonderful (until we were driving home at least). The company delightful.


It was a lovely, lovely weekend!
